边缘身份:解构TP钱包的创建、存储与跨链运行机制

当你在TP钱包创建一个新钱包时,它并不“存在”于某个服务器目录,而是以密钥材料与配置的形式分布在你的设备、可选备份与链上交互端点之间。技术指南式地看清楚这条链路,能让你把钱包当作边缘身份与交易节点来管理。

首先,创建流程:TP在本地生成助记词(BIP39)与私钥,私钥被加密后存入应用的安全存储(Android Keystore或iOS Keychain/Enclave),并可导出为Keystore JSON或硬件签名路径。用户可选择本地备份、手抄助记词或加密云备份;任何云备份都应由用户密码端到端加密。

实时支付监控需要两层:链上事件监听与节点指令。采用WebSocket或WebRTC订阅RPC节点的pending/confirmed事件,结合轻量级索引器(如The Graph或自建事件索引),可实现入账提醒、风控打点与延迟告警。为最低延迟,部署区域化RPC或使用专业提供商并建立冗余回退链路。

合约调用从ABI编码到签名广播是标准流程。读操作通过eth_call在节点上执行无需签名;写操作由客户端本地组装交易、估算gas、用私钥离线签名,再通过指定RPC提交。对于复杂合约交互,建议使用nonce管理、链下交易队列和重试策略以避免并发冲突。

专业视角关注可审计性与密钥生命周期:在企业场景考虑多签、门限签名(TSS)或硬件模块(HSM)托管。合规与审计需求要求将关键事件(备份、更改网络、合约授权)以不可篡改日志形式上报或上链证据化。

全球化与创新体现在多链与锚定资产策略:TP支持自定义网络与RPC,允许接入公链、侧链和许可链,同时通过稳定币或链上锚定资产(法币锚定代币、资产证明)实现价值锚定与流动性对接。跨链桥与原子互换配合Oracles可保持锚定可靠性。

可定制化网络意味着用户/企业能添加任意ChainID、Explorer URL、自定义Gas策略与速率限制;结合沙箱环境与测试网演练,是安全上线的必备步骤。

总结:TP钱包在用户设备上既是密钥库也是边缘交易节点,理解其本地存储、事件订阅、合约签名与网络配置流程,能把握实时支付监控、合约调用和全球化资产锚定的核心要点,从而把钱包构建为安全、可审计且可扩展的交易与身份控制平面。

作者:林海辰发布时间:2025-12-17 12:58:21

评论

小赵

写得很实用,尤其是关于WebSocket监控和索引器的部分,帮我解决了延迟告警的问题。

EthanW

关于云备份端到端加密的提醒很到位,之前就忽略了这一点。

李珂

多签和TSS在企业场景的建议非常专业,已收藏准备实施。

NinaChen

把钱包看作边缘身份很新颖,文章把技术细节和实践流程衔接得很好。

相关阅读